Ingredients
2 pounds (900g) beef chuck roast or stew beef, cut into chunks
3 tablespoons olive oil
1 large onion, finely chopped
2 carrots, peeled and chopped
2 celery stalks, chopped
4 cloves garlic, minced
1 can (28 oz) crushed tomatoes
2 cups Halal-certified beef broth
2 tablespoons tomato paste
1 teaspoon dried oregano
1 teaspoon dried thyme
2 bay leaves
Salt and pepper, to taste
1 pound (450g) pappardelle pasta (Halal-certified)
Freshly grated Parmesan cheese (optional)
Fresh basil or parsley, for garnish (optional)
Instructions
- Heat 2 tablespoons of olive oil in a large pot or Dutch oven over medium-high heat.
- Season the beef with salt and pepper and brown in batches until deeply seared. Remove and set aside.
- Add the remaining olive oil to the pot and sauté the onion, carrots, and celery for 5–7 minutes until softened.
- Add the garlic and cook for 30 seconds until fragrant.
- Stir in the tomato paste and cook for 2–3 minutes to deepen the flavor.
- Add crushed tomatoes, beef broth, oregano, thyme, and bay leaves.
- Return the beef to the pot, bring to a gentle simmer, then reduce heat and partially cover.
- Simmer for 2–2½ hours, stirring occasionally, until the beef is fork-tender.
- Remove the beef, shred it with forks, and return it to the sauce. Simmer for 10 more minutes.
- Meanwhile, cook the pappardelle in salted boiling water according to package instructions.
- Drain the pasta, reserving a little pasta water.
- Add pasta to the ragu and toss to coat, adding pasta water if needed.
- Serve hot with Parmesan and fresh herbs if desired.
Notes
The ragu tastes even better the next day.
Chuck roast is ideal for tenderness and flavor.
Freeze the sauce without pasta for best results.
Add a splash of cream at the end for extra richness.
- Prep Time: 30 minutes
- Cook Time: 2 hours 30 minutes
- Category: Main Course
- Method: Simmering
- Cuisine: Italian
- Diet: Halal
Nutrition
- Serving Size: 1 bowl
- Calories: 610
- Sugar: 8g
- Sodium: 640mg
- Fat: 26g
- Saturated Fat: 9g
- Unsaturated Fat: 15g
- Trans Fat: 0g
- Carbohydrates: 52g
- Fiber: 5g
- Protein: 42g
- Cholesterol: 120mg